Nintendo has confirmed a new Nintendo Direct showcase will air on Tuesday, 4 August, dedicated entirely to Fire Emblem: Fortune's Weave, the next instalment in its long-running tactical role-playing game series. The presentation matters as it offers the first detailed look at the Switch 2 exclusive ahead of its release next month, giving fans insight into its story, characters and gameplay systems before launch.

The stream will begin at 7am PDT / 10am EDT on Nintendo's YouTube channel and is expected to run for around 20 minutes. Fortune's Weave, first announced last September, follows four new heroes competing in the Dagsion Heroic Games, a colosseum-style tournament overseen by a godlike figure called the Divine Sovereign, with the winner granted a wish. Outside of battles, players can explore the city of Dagsion, train, recruit allies and venture beyond its walls; the game, which appears to be a prequel to 2019's Fire Emblem: Three Houses, is due out on Switch 2 on 17 September.
